The story of Thomas Sylvanus Roy began in 1910 in MT Pleasant, Texas. In 1920, Thomas Sylvanus Roy resided in Mount Pleasant, Titus, Texas, USA. Thomas Sylvanus Roy passed away in 1920 in MT Pleasant, Titus, Texas, USA.
